The North Carolina Graduation Project is a multi-faceted, multi-disciplinary performance assessment, which provides each student the opportunity to connect content knowledge, acquired skill, and work habits to real world situations and issues.

During June 2009, the NC General Assembly signed law HB223 which states, “The State Board of Education shall not require any student to prepare a high school graduation project as a condition of graduation from high school prior to July 1, 2011; local boards of education may, however, require their students to complete a high school graduation project.” The RSS Board of Education will continue to require a graduation project as a local exit standard.

The Graduation Project process provides opportunities for family and community members to support our students as they move through this graduation requirement.
